| package org.apache.zookeeper.common; |
| |
| import static org.junit.jupiter.api.Assertions.assertEquals; |
| import static org.junit.jupiter.api.Assertions.assertNull; |
| import static org.junit.jupiter.api.Assertions.assertThrows; |
| import org.apache.zookeeper.ZKTestCase; |
| import org.junit.jupiter.api.Test; |
| |
| public class PathUtilsTest extends ZKTestCase { |
| |
| @Test |
| public void testValidatePath_ValidPath() { |
| PathUtils.validatePath("/this is / a valid/path"); |
| } |
| |
| @Test |
| public void testValidatePath_Null()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ath(null);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_EmptyString()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ath("");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_NotAbsolutePath()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("not/valid"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_EndsWithSlash()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/ends/with/slash/"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_ContainsNullCharacter()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/test\u0000"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_DoubleSlash()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/double//slash"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_SinglePeriod()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/single/./period"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_DoublePeriod()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/double/../period"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_NameContainingPeriod() { |
| // A period that isn't on its own is ok |
| PathUtils.validatePath("/name/with.period."); |
| } |
| |
| @Test |
| public void testValidatePath_0x01()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/test\u0001"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_0x1F()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/test\u001F"); |
| }); |
| } |
| |
| @Test // The first allowable character |
| public void testValidatePath_0x20() { |
| PathUtils.validatePath("/test\u0020"); |
| } |
| |
| @Test |
| public void testValidatePath_0x7e() { |
| // The last valid ASCII character |
| PathUtils.validatePath("/test\u007e"); |
| } |
| |
| @Test |
| public void testValidatePath_0x7f()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/test\u007f"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_0x9f()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/test\u009f"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_ud800()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/test\ud800"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_uf8ff()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/test\uf8ff"); |
| }); |
| } |
| |
| @Test |
| public void testValidatePath_HighestAllowableChar() { |
| PathUtils.validatePath("/test\uffef"); |
| } |
| |
| @Test |
| public void testValidatePath_SupplementaryChar() { |
| assertThrows(IllegalArgumentException.class, () -> { |
| PathUtils.validatePath("/test\ufff0"); |
| }); |
| } |
| |
| @Test |
| public void testGetTopNamespace() { |
| assertEquals("n0", PathUtils.getTopNamespace("/n0/n1/n2/n3")); |
| assertNull(PathUtils.getTopNamespace("/")); |
| assertNull(PathUtils.getTopNamespace("")); |
| assertNull(PathUtils.getTopNamespace(null)); |
| } |
| } |
